An unusual, atypical blend of Beaujolais Gamay grapes, Jura varieties and Chardonnay, J'Y Aime has a seductive juiciness and natural crunch.
More infoJ'Y Aime is an unusual, unique blend of Gamay produced from Beaujolais, various Jura grapes and Chardonnay. Its red cherry colour exudes a complex aromatic bouquet rich in fruity, spicy, floral notes. Silky and juicy, it has undergone three weeks' semi-carbonic maceration. Fermentation is triggered by native yeasts, and sulphur is not used in the vinification process.
About the Producer Anne et Jean-François Ganevat
Undisputed icon of the Jura, Jean-François Ganevat has made a reputation for himself as one of the region's top producers. Having learnt the ropes with Jean-Marc Morey in Chassagne-Montrachet, he decided to create his own domain, which he farms organically and biodynamically. Reflecting Burgundian savoir-faire, he produces single-parcel micro cuvées. In the winery, his prefers a hands off approach, allowing the wine to express itself. Domain Anne et Jean-François Ganevat is the name of the négociant business set up by Jean-François and his wife. Quality is top priority, and the couple strive to produce wines in exactly the same way as at their own domain.
